Understanding the Side Impact Test and “Good” Rating for Benz GLE 2019
The side impact test simulates a collision where a vehicle is struck on the side by another vehicle or object. This is a critical area of safety assessment, as side impacts can pose significant risks to occupants. The “Good” rating signifies that the vehicle provides a high level of protection in such a crash scenario.
The evaluation encompasses several key aspects, including:
- Overall Evaluation: This is the summary rating, and the Benz GLE achieves the highest mark: “Good.”
- Structure and Safety Cage: A “Good” rating here indicates that the structural integrity of the GLE’s safety cage is maintained during a side impact, minimizing intrusion into the occupant compartment.
- Driver and Rear Passenger Injury Measures: These assessments evaluate the risk of injury to critical body regions. For the Benz GLE, “Good” ratings are consistently achieved across all measured areas for both the driver and rear passenger, including:
- Head/Neck: Indicating low risk of injury to the head and neck.
- Torso: Signifying effective protection of the chest and abdomen.
- Pelvis/Leg: Demonstrating good protection for the pelvis and legs.
- Driver and Rear Passenger Head Protection: Crucially, “Good” ratings are also awarded for head protection for both front and rear occupants. This is largely due to the standard side curtain airbags which deploy in side-impact collisions to cushion the head and prevent contact with hard surfaces.
Technical Insights from Side Impact Testing
To provide a more detailed understanding, technical measurements from the side impact tests are crucial. These measurements quantify the performance of the vehicle in protecting occupants.
Occupant Compartment Intrusion:
Measurements of intrusion into the driver’s side of the occupant compartment are vital in assessing structural performance. Negative values indicate how much the deformation stopped short of the driver’s seat centerline. In tests (identified as VTS1115 and VTS1313), the B-pillar intrusion relative to the driver’s seat centerline was measured at -20.0 cm and -19.0 cm respectively. These negative numbers suggest minimal intrusion into the space surrounding the driver, contributing to the “Good” rating for structural integrity.
Driver and Passenger Injury Measures – Detailed Data:
The tests also involve measuring forces and deflections on crash test dummies representing both the driver and rear passenger. Lower numbers generally indicate better performance and lower risk of injury.
For the driver, key measurements include:
- Head HIC-15: Head Injury Criterion (lower is better). Measurements were 64 and 52 in the two tests.
- Neck Tension and Compression: Forces on the neck (lower is better).
- Shoulder Deflection and Force: Measures of shoulder movement and forces.
- Torso Deflection: Maximum and average deflection of the torso, along with viscous criterion, indicating chest compression.
- Pelvis Forces: Forces on the iliac and acetabulum areas of the pelvis.
- Femur Forces and Moments: Forces and moments on the left femur.
